支持 30+ AI 大模型!一站式聚合 GPT-4、Claude、DeepSeek、通义千问、文心一言等全球顶级模型!
在 AI 开发的世界里,调用多个大模型 API 已经成为常态。OpenAI、Claude、Gemini、DeepSeek、通义千问、讯飞星火……如何统一管理这些 API,并优化调用策略?
今天,我们就来介绍一款 强大且开源的 AI API 聚合管理工具——One API!它能 整合不同厂商的 AI 接口,自动切换 API Key,提供负载均衡、流量管理、成本控制,甚至支持私有化部署,让你的 AI 项目更加稳定高效!
📌 项目地址:GitHub - One API
🚀 One API 能做什么?
如果你经常调用 AI API,肯定遇到过这些问题:
- 不同 AI 平台 API Key 需要单独管理,手动切换很麻烦。
- 部分 API 访问不稳定,经常超时、失败,影响业务。
- 不同 API 价格不同,如何找到最优性价比?
- 接口格式各不相同,代码兼容性差,改起来头疼。
One API 轻松解决这些痛点!
✅ 支持 30+ AI 大模型 API:**OpenAI、Claude、Gemini、DeepSeek、Qwen、智谱、百川、Moonshot、Mistral……**一站式管理!
✅ API Key 智能管理:多个 Key 轮询调用,避免超量封禁,提高 API 可靠性!
✅ 智能负载均衡:自动在不同 API 之间切换,保证调用成功率!
✅ 流量 & 费用控制:设置不同 API 的优先级,降低 AI 计算成本!
✅ OpenAI API 兼容:只需修改 API 地址,现有项目可无缝迁移,无需改代码!
✅ 私有化部署,数据更安全:企业 & 个人都能搭建自己的 AI API 代理平台!
🔗 One API 支持的 AI 模型
One API 目前已支持 30+ AI API,包括主流的开源 & 商业大模型:
🎯 主流 AI 大模型
- OpenAI(GPT-4、GPT-3.5,支持 Azure OpenAI)
- Claude(Anthropic Claude 系列,支持 AWS Claude)
- Google Gemini / PaLM 2
- DeepSeek AI(深度求索)
- 智谱 ChatGLM、百川 Baichuan、Moonshot AI
- 百度文心一言、阿里通义千问、讯飞星火、字节跳动豆包
- Mistral AI、Groq、Cohere、零一万物
- 腾讯混元、360 智脑、硅基流动(SiliconCloud)
🎨 AI 绘图 & 翻译
- DeepL 翻译
- Cloudflare Workers AI
- Together.AI、Novita.AI
📌 第三方 API & 代理支持
- Cloudflare AI Gateway(支持高性能代理请求)
- 支持自定义镜像 & 第三方 API 代理
🔥 只需接入 One API,即可调用这些模型,无需单独对接每个平台!
🛠 One API 核心功能
📌 1. API 聚合 & 负载均衡
- 统一 API 入口,开发者只需调用 One API,One API 自动匹配最佳 AI 服务。
- 支持 API 轮询、自动切换,避免 Key 失效或超量封禁。
- 可按权重配置不同 API,优先调用低成本/高稳定性的服务。
📌 2. API Key 统一管理 & 安全防护
- 支持多渠道 API Key 轮询,防止 Key 被封导致服务中断。
- 可配置 API Key 限额、失效时间、IP 访问控制,提高安全性。
- 支持令牌管理,用户可创建独立 API Key,适用于团队协作。
📌 3. 成本优化 & 调用策略
- 智能 API 费用管理,让 AI 调用成本更可控。
- 按流量 & 权重自动分配 API Key,优先调用最便宜的 AI 服务。
📌 4. OpenAI API 兼容,无缝迁移
One API 支持 OpenAI 兼容模式,只需改 API 地址即可对接现有应用!
export OPENAI_API_BASE=https://your-one-api.com/v1
📌 5. 多用户管理 & 统计分析
- 支持用户分组,不同用户可分配不同 AI 调用权限。
- 提供详细的 API 调用日志,方便数据分析 & 费用控制。
🚀 快速部署 One API(支持 Docker & 手动安装)
1️⃣ Docker 一键部署(推荐)
docker run --name one-api -d --restart always -p 3000:3000 \
-e TZ=Asia/Shanghai \
-v /home/ubuntu/data/one-api:/data \
justsong/one-api
然后访问 http://localhost:3000
进行配置。
2️⃣ 手动部署(适用于服务器)
git clone https://github.com/songquanpeng/one-api.git
cd one-api
go build -o one-api
./one-api
默认 One API 运行在 http://localhost:3000
。
3️⃣ 配置 OpenAI API 兼容模式
export OPENAI_API_BASE=https://your-one-api.com/v1
4️⃣ Nginx 反向代理(可选)
server {
server_name api.yourdomain.com;
location / {
proxy_pass http://localhost:3000;
proxy_set_header Host $host;
proxy_set_header X-Forwarded-For $remote_addr;
}
}
💡 One API 适用于谁?
✅ 个人开发者:用 One API 统一管理所有 AI API,提高开发效率。
✅ 企业团队:搭建私有 AI API 代理,提高安全性 & 降低调用成本。
✅ AI SaaS 服务商:用 One API 聚合多个大模型,为客户提供多样化 AI 解决方案。
✅ AI 代理平台:如果你想运营一个 AI API 代理商店,One API 是完美工具!
📢 总结:为什么 One API 值得一试?
- 支持 30+ AI 大模型,API 统一管理,兼容 OpenAI 标准
- 自动切换 API,智能负载均衡,降低 AI 计算成本
- 支持 Docker 快速部署,支持私有化 & 团队协作
- 适用于 AI 开发者、企业、SaaS 平台,打造高效 AI API 调用系统
💻 GitHub 开源地址:https://github.com/songquanpeng/one-api